The Ultimate Buying Guide: Your Guide to Vacuum Cleaners with Attachments
Why Attachments Matter
Vacuum cleaners with attachments are super helpful. They let you clean more than just your floors. You can clean furniture, tight corners, and even your car. This guide will help you pick the best one for your home.
Key Features to Look For
1. Suction Power
Good suction power means your vacuum will pick up dirt and dust effectively. Look for vacuums with high wattage or air watts. This is like the vacuum’s strength.
2. Filtration System
A good filtration system traps tiny dust particles and allergens. This is great for people with allergies or asthma. HEPA filters are the best for this.
3. Bagged vs. Bagless
Bagged vacuums collect dirt in a bag. You throw the bag away when it’s full. Bagless vacuums have a bin you empty. Bagless is often more convenient and eco-friendly.
4. Weight and Maneuverability
You’ll be moving the vacuum around. A lighter vacuum is easier to push and carry. Swivel steering makes it easy to turn corners.
5. Cord Length or Battery Life
For corded vacuums, a longer cord means you can clean more rooms without unplugging. For cordless vacuums, check the battery life. Make sure it’s long enough for your cleaning needs.
Important Materials
The materials used in a vacuum affect its durability and performance.
- Plastic: Most vacuums use plastic. High-quality plastic lasts longer and resists cracks.
- Metal: Some parts, like the wand or brush roll, might be metal. Metal parts are usually stronger.
- Brush Roll Bristles: These can be nylon or a mix of materials. Stiffer bristles clean carpets better. Softer bristles are good for hard floors.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Quality Enhancers:
- Strong Motor: A powerful motor provides excellent suction.
- Durable Construction: Well-built vacuums last longer.
- Effective Attachments: The right attachments make cleaning easier.
- Good Filtration: Traps more dirt and allergens.
Quality Reducers:
- Weak Motor: Poor suction means less cleaning power.
- Cheap Plastic: Can break easily.
- Poorly Designed Attachments: May not work well.
- Ineffective Filtration: Lets dust escape back into the air.
User Experience and Use Cases
Think about how you will use your vacuum.
- Apartments: A compact, lightweight vacuum with good maneuverability is ideal.
- Homes with Pets: Look for strong suction and specialized pet hair attachments.
- People with Allergies: A HEPA filter is a must.
- Cars: A handheld vacuum or one with a crevice tool is perfect for car interiors.
- Stairs: Lightweight models or those with a hose and wand make stair cleaning easier.
Attachments are a game-changer. A crevice tool cleans tight spaces. An upholstery tool cleans sofas and chairs. A dusting brush is great for delicate surfaces. A pet hair tool tackles stubborn fur.
